MONTAGUE, NJ - On the evening of March 5, 2010 the Montague Fire Department was dispatched to an address on River Road for an activated fire alarm. While units were en-route to the alarm call, they were also dispatched to a reported rollover with entrapment on River Road. Montague Chief 1 requested Milford, PA Rescue to the scene of the rollover and Sandyston Fire Police to shut down River Road at State Highway 206.

Montague Engine 2 and Support responded to the scene of the rollover while other units checked out the fire alarm call which turned out to be a false alarm. At this time Montague Fire first responders and Blue Ridge Rescue were also dispatched to a medical call in the High Point Country Club. Additional units responded to that call as well.

Montague Fire units made contact with the trapped patient in the rollover. There were no serious injuries. Milford Rescue 33 removed the driver door with the jaws so Montague and Blue Ridge units could remove the patient from the vehicle.

A special thanks to all Montague, Sandyston, Milford and Blue Ridge members for their assistance with the multiple incidents.

The New Jersey State Police is still investigating the cause of the accident. Montague units stayed on scene until the vehicle was towed.
